Transformative Projects: From Concept to Reality

Dive has successfully translated its R&D initiatives into tangible projects that address real-world problems. One notable example is the development of an Email Agent designed for project managers, which arose from the need to streamline management tasks. This project leveraged ongoing experimentation with natural language processing models, demonstrating how curiosity can lead to practical solutions.

Another significant achievement is Dive's image comparison model, which replaced a previously outsourced service. This transition was not merely reactive; it was the product of extensive proactive research into optimal alternatives. The result was a tool that enhanced operational margins and positioned Dive to offer more competitive solutions.

Currently, Dive is exploring object recognition technology aimed at enhancing tennis match analysis. This initiative seeks to generate actionable insights that can inform players' performance through data-driven decisions. Such projects exemplify how R&D can intersect with diverse sectors, creating value across various industries.

Strategic Selection of Projects

In the realm of R&D, the selection of projects is a critical step. Dive's approach involves exploring emerging tools and technologies in AI and data science, aligning these insights with internal needs such as product development and cost efficiency. The process of "cherry-picking" involves evaluating potential projects based on their feasibility and strategic importance. Key leaders, including co-CEO Leticia Gómez and Head of Consulting Ulises Quevedo, play an integral role in this evaluation, ensuring that selected projects are well-defined and aligned with the organization's objectives.
